Nemo."Nemo" 1973 (members Cruciferious,Ergo Sum) French Jazz Rock Fusion.

This group could be seen as a fusion of the groups Ergo Sum and Cruciferius (adding the drummer Clement Bailly from Tryptique). Like these bands, Nemo used English lyrics and played dynamic jazz-rock with some hints of "zeuhl" rock in the throbbing bass lines. In other places the cool funky electric piano and ethnic hand percussion are not unlike 70's Santana. Nemo emphasized rock melodies, though, offering a couple of gems among the 8 tracks. These range from the straight-forward hippie-rock of "Straight Man" to the reflective instrumental "Grandeur Et Misere Du Perou". Not among the really top albums but still worth investigation due to excellent musicianship.

Bass Guitar, Piano – Pascal Arroyo
Drums – Clément Bailly
Engineer – Dominique Blanc Francard*
Guitar, Voice – Marc Perru
Percussion, Guitar – Emmanuel Lacordaire
Photography – Gilbert Nencioli, Jean Grelet
Piano [Electric], Organ, Voice, Artwork By – François Bréant
